The S6F33 is a special quality version of the 6F33 RF pentode, the structure is open with the anode being formed by two small plates that are strapped together. The suppressor grid is closely spaced and the valve has a very short suppressor grid control curve.
The maximum anode dissipation is 3 Watts and the fine wire screen grid dissipation is up to 1.5 Watts.
The thin glass tube envelope is 18 mm in diameter, and excluding the base pins is 44 mm tall.
References: Datasheet, 1040 & Ray Cooper. Type S6F33 was first introduced¶ in 1961.
